01: /**
02: * <copyright>
03: * </copyright>
04: *
05: * $Id: VersionedDeleteElementType.java 7988 2007-12-12 20:29:15Z aaime $
06: */package net.opengis.wfsv;
07:
08: import net.opengis.wfs.DeleteElementType;
09:
10: /**
11: * <!-- begin-user-doc -->
12: * A representation of the model object '<em><b>Versioned Delete Element Type</b></em>'.
13: * <!-- end-user-doc -->
14: *
15: * <p>
16: * The following features are supported:
17: * <ul>
18: * <li>{@link net.opengis.wfsv.VersionedDeleteElementType#getFeatureVersion <em>Feature Version</em>}</li>
19: * </ul>
20: * </p>
21: *
22: * @see net.opengis.wfsv.WfsvPackage#getVersionedDeleteElementType()
23: * @model extendedMetaData="name='VersionedDeleteElementType' kind='elementOnly'"
24: * @generated
25: */
26: public interface VersionedDeleteElementType extends DeleteElementType {
27: /**
28: * Returns the value of the '<em><b>Feature Version</b></em>' attribute.
29: * <!-- begin-user-doc -->
30: * <!-- end-user-doc -->
31: * <!-- begin-model-doc -->
32: *
33: * See VersionedUpdateElementType featureVersion attribute.
34: *
35: * <!-- end-model-doc -->
36: * @return the value of the '<em>Feature Version</em>' attribute.
37: * @see #setFeatureVersion(String)
38: * @see net.opengis.wfsv.WfsvPackage#getVersionedDeleteElementType_FeatureVersion()
39: * @model dataType="org.eclipse.emf.ecore.xml.type.String" required="true"
40: * extendedMetaData="kind='attribute' name='featureVersion'"
41: * @generated
42: */
43: String getFeatureVersion();
44:
45: /**
46: * Sets the value of the '{@link net.opengis.wfsv.VersionedDeleteElementType#getFeatureVersion <em>Feature Version</em>}' attribute.
47: * <!-- begin-user-doc -->
48: * <!-- end-user-doc -->
49: * @param value the new value of the '<em>Feature Version</em>' attribute.
50: * @see #getFeatureVersion()
51: * @generated
52: */
53: void setFeatureVersion(String value);
54:
55: } // VersionedDeleteElementType
|